How are WhatsApp contacts written?

How are WhatsApp contacts written - briefly?

To write a contact on WhatsApp, you use the phone number of the person you wish to reach, ensuring that it is entered in international format. For example, for a US-based contact, you would enter +1 followed by the area code and the local number. This ensures global recognition and proper delivery of messages.

Firstly, it's essential to understand that WhatsApp uses phone numbers as unique identifiers for its users. This means that when you add a new contact on WhatsApp, the primary piece of information you need is their phone number. The format in which this phone number is entered can vary depending on the country and regional settings.

For instance, if you are adding a contact from the United States, you would typically enter the phone number as follows: +1 123-456-7890. The plus sign (+) is used to denote the country code, which in this case is 1 for the USA. Following the country code, the area code (if applicable) and the local phone number are entered. It's crucial to include the country code to ensure that WhatsApp can correctly identify and connect with the contact.
